Ensemble comprised of shorts, belt, pouch, bottle and net bag

Description

FIG. 1 is a front perspective view of an ensemble comprised of shorts, belt, pouch, bottle and net bag showing my new design with the side pocket shown open, the belt, pouch, bottle and bag being removed, and the broken lines showing a key, key ring, and currency in FIGS. 1, 2, 7, 11, and 12 being for illustrative purposes only, forming no part of the claimed design;

FIG. 2 is a rear perspective view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a left side elevational view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a right side elevational view thereof, the side pocket shown patially closed;

FIG. 5 is a left perspective view of the bottle, bag and belt portion of the claimed design shown in FIG. 11;

FIG. 6 is a right perspective view of FIG. 5;

FIG. 7 is a front elevational view of FIG. 5, the pouch shown open;

FIG. 8 is a rear elevational view of FIG. 5;

FIG. 9 is a top plan view of FIG. 5;

FIG. 10 is a bottom plan view of FIG. 5;

FIG. 11 is a front perspective view of an ensemble comprised of shorts, belt, pouch, bottle and net bag showing my new design;

FIG. 12 is a reduced front perspective view of FIG. 1 in the condition of use; the broken lines showing a human form in FIG. 12 and 13being for illustrative purposes only and forming no part of the claimed design; and,

FIG. 13 is a reduced front perspective view of FIG. 7, the pouch shown in a closed position.

The broken lines shown on the claimed design in FIGS. 1-7, 9, and 11-13 are understood to represent conventional stitching.
